Jacob Baime ICC has been the Chief Executive Officer of the Israel on Campus Coalition since 2013, leading the organization in its mission to empower and unite college students in their advocacy for Israel across the United States. Under his leadership, ICC maintains a 24/7 National Operations Center to ensure a consistent and robust pro-Israel presence on campuses. He has been instrumental in advancing a technology-driven research agenda that enhances the coalition's outreach and engagement strategies. Additionally, he promotes widespread collaboration across various platforms, highlighting the critical importance of unified actions to achieve collective goals. Before his current role, Jacob was the National Field Director at the American Israel Public Affairs Committee (AIPAC). There, he led a team of field organizers and managed strategic initiatives on campuses nationwide, significantly boosting AIPAC's influence across the country. His responsibilities also included overseeing AIPAC's training programs for students, demonstrating his commitment to developing the next generation of leaders in pro-Israel advocacy. His dedication to public service is also reflected in his earlier roles as Area Director for AIPAC in the New England Region and as a political aide to the Lieutenant Governor of Massachusetts. These positions not only broadened his political insights but also enabled him to make substantial contributions to the discourse on U.S.-Israel relations.
